The Grateful Dead became the first rock band to perform at the foot of the Sphinx of Giza when they traveled to Egypt with three concerts in 1978.

Dead bassist Phil Lesh still reflects on the experience with admiration decades later, recalling in his 2005 memoir, "History fuses myth and will descend into reality."

Since then, the Giza Pyramid Complex has played host to concerts, for example Sting in 2001 and Yanni in 2015.

2. Chichen Itza, Mexico

The ancient Mayan city of Chichen Itza dates back to 600 AD and still stands as one of the most important remaining historical heritage sites in North America.

This sacred building site has played host to large-scale performances among the pyramids during the 2008 opera star Placido Domingo's footsteps, followed by another concert, namely pop icon Elton John in 2010.

3. Colosseum, Italy

Although this Colosseum in Italy has not yet reached the scale of large concerts being held at other historical sites, the head caretaker of the Colosseum has just announced his desire to reactivate Italy's most visited historic site with rock concerts.

So far, the Colosseum has hosted charity concerts featuring Elton John, Andrea Bocelli and Steven Tyler of Aerosmith, as well as a familiar appearance by Paul McCartney in 2003.
